P. S. Sreedharan Pillai, born on December 1, 1954, in Kerala, is a Bharatiya Janata Party (BJP) politician and the Governor of Goa. Prior to this, he was the Governor of Mizoram from November 5, 2019, to July 6, 2021, where the Chief Justice of Gauhati High Court Justice Ajay Lamba at Raj Bhavan conducted his swearing-in ceremony.

PS Sreedharan Pillai has an interest in writing. His first book was published in 1983. By the time he became the governor, his 105 books were published. 

Sreedharan’s political career started with ABVP when he was studying in college. He was the BJP State President from 2003 to 2006 and later got appointed as the President in 2018. Pilai was associated with a National Volunteer Organisation – The Rashtriya Swayamsevak Sangh from childhood days. 

The 67-year-old said in an interview that he spent most of his time after official duty during the lockdown in reading and writing. “I would wake up at four in the morning and start reading and writing after exercising,” he said. He thinks that leaders and mass workers should inculcate the habit of reading books to educate the people. 

Pillai further said that the lockdown implemented to prevent the spread of coronavirus gave him more free time to read and write books. Nobody was allowed to enter the Raj Bhavan. His communication with people was also closed, and all of his upcoming trips were postponed for some time.  

Pillai started writing three decades ago. His first book was published in 1983. Before becoming the governor, 105 books were published by him. Till now, he has written at least 121 books in different categories.
